But one of the best, as far as I'm concerned, is the electric blanket. This wonderful device, if turned on a half hour before you crawl, slide or flop into bed, depending on your nature, will assure you a toasty warm welcome. Our electric blanket has dual controls so my spouse and I can adjust our sides to suit ourselves. This is the same basic design that all of the electric blankest I have ever owned have shared.
But now I'm beginning to wonder. Is anyone working on an AI controlled electric blanket that senses your body's warmth needs and adjusts accordingly, up and down, all through the night? What a nice thought.
Now, of course, as so often happens when I write these blogs, I feel compelled to do a little research. Guess what. AI controlled electric blankets do exist, almost. You can buy such a blanket made by Sunbeam for $99. That's just one brand that I found. These blankets, more accurately called Smart blankets or Wi-Fi blankets respond to voice commands. This isn't really AI in my opinion. I want a blanket that senses my warmth needs minute by minute, all night long without any verbal or other input from me. That would be a real AI blanket.
